Colonel,
I agree with spilner, MAGNAFLOW ftw! I can also do a sound clip if you want to hear. I have a magnaflow highflo-cat (#99204HM), magnaflow muffler(#10416) as a resonator (to ELIMINATE the rasp), and a magnaflow muffler (#14807) out the back. These are the product numbers for the equipment I have and you can get them from planetmagnaflow.com. I can vouch for them as they are a good company with excellent customer service. -Smurf- |
